VSCode 在编辑器鼠标悬停与问题窗格中显示不同的 Pylint 错误
VSCode shows different Pylint errors in editor mouseover versus problems pane
作为 VSCode(版本 1.27.2)的新用户,我正在尝试 运行 Pylint(Python 3.6 上的版本 2.1.1)与许多像 design checker 一样启用了额外的检查器,但即使错误显示在编辑器 window 的鼠标悬停上,它们也没有列在问题窗格中。在下图中,您可以在鼠标悬停时看到至少 3 个,但在问题窗格中只能看到 2 个。 (实际上编辑器中总共有 5 个,而问题窗格中仍然只有 2 个。)我在我的用户设置中有 "python.linting.pylintUseMinimalCheckers": false,
,而且我在我的用户设置中发送了额外的检查器 "python.linting.pylintArgs": ["--load-plugins", "pylint.extensions.mccabe"],
但是似乎缺少某些设置,我认为这些设置会正确显示在编辑器中鼠标悬停时看到的相同错误。谁能帮忙?缺少的似乎是 'R' 类型的 pylint 错误——重构类型。
似乎 VSCode 的问题面板显示错误、信息和警告,但不显示提示。我找不到这方面的文档,但测试似乎表明情况确实如此。由于 Pylint 重构问题默认为 VSCode 设置中的提示,因此它们不会显示。将该设置更改为这 3 个值中的任何一个最终会在问题面板中显示 "hints"。我希望我可以简单地在问题面板中包含 "hints",但我找不到该设置。不过这很好用。
作为 VSCode(版本 1.27.2)的新用户,我正在尝试 运行 Pylint(Python 3.6 上的版本 2.1.1)与许多像 design checker 一样启用了额外的检查器,但即使错误显示在编辑器 window 的鼠标悬停上,它们也没有列在问题窗格中。在下图中,您可以在鼠标悬停时看到至少 3 个,但在问题窗格中只能看到 2 个。 (实际上编辑器中总共有 5 个,而问题窗格中仍然只有 2 个。)我在我的用户设置中有 "python.linting.pylintUseMinimalCheckers": false,
,而且我在我的用户设置中发送了额外的检查器 "python.linting.pylintArgs": ["--load-plugins", "pylint.extensions.mccabe"],
但是似乎缺少某些设置,我认为这些设置会正确显示在编辑器中鼠标悬停时看到的相同错误。谁能帮忙?缺少的似乎是 'R' 类型的 pylint 错误——重构类型。
似乎 VSCode 的问题面板显示错误、信息和警告,但不显示提示。我找不到这方面的文档,但测试似乎表明情况确实如此。由于 Pylint 重构问题默认为 VSCode 设置中的提示,因此它们不会显示。将该设置更改为这 3 个值中的任何一个最终会在问题面板中显示 "hints"。我希望我可以简单地在问题面板中包含 "hints",但我找不到该设置。不过这很好用。